Overview
- Hilaria Baldwin explains her fluctuating Spanish accent as a result of ADHD and dyslexia, which she says impact her speech, memory, and confidence.
- The memoir addresses the 2020 controversy over her Spanish identity, clarifying her parents moved to Spain when she was 27, not during her childhood.
- Baldwin candidly discusses the severe mental health toll of public backlash, including suicidal thoughts and questioning her self-worth.
- She reveals a near-divorce in 2015, describing a rocky period in her marriage and crediting Alec Baldwin for his empathy and support during her recovery.
- Baldwin criticizes an unnamed celebrity, widely inferred to be Amy Schumer, for making 'nasty and untrue' remarks about her and her family in a comedy special.
